My memory card only has about 1.5 megabytes left and I was wondering if this is enough to install the exploit. I already have this on one memory card but I wanted to put it on a second one too so if I just copy the corrupted data block to the other memory card, does this still work as well? Thanks.

Hdloader is about 700kb and is stored in the system config file.
Im not sure if you can just copy it over to the other memory card??
Youll probably have to install it again m8.
